From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p11.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ms5.migadu.com with LMTPS id tx6cOTPDu2NU8QAAbAwnHQ (envelope-from ) for ; Mon, 09 Jan 2023 08:33:08 +0100 Received: from aspmx1.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p11.migadu.com with LMTPS id GEfWODPDu2NfUAEA9RJhRA (envelope-from ) for ; Mon, 09 Jan 2023 08:33:07 +0100 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 8C5B42558C for ; Mon, 9 Jan 2023 08:33:07 +0100 (CET)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1pEme7-0001Tp-JB; Mon, 09 Jan 2023 02:32:40 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pEmdy-0001TH-UB for guix-devel@gnu.org; Mon, 09 Jan 2023 02:32:32 -0500 Received: from mout02.posteo.de ([185.67.36.66]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pEmdw-00025v-LJ for guix-devel@gnu.org; Mon, 09 Jan 2023 02:32:30 -0500 Received: from submission (posteo.de [185.67.36.169]) by mout02.posteo.de (Postfix) with ESMTPS id 2EC71240231 for ; Mon, 9 Jan 2023 08:32:24 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=posteo.net; s=2017; t=1673249544; bh=CGY4xZBBjFcKsf/805vY0DSQ43+Imj+mYuZzgDlpK30=; h=From:To:Cc:Subject:Date:From; b=HpKI9Iu4/AIMRsnUX9aPUijxj+poz6tyc56UiWOPFQ8y7IJvDwCTTF/2JyODBprS4 MNSOENG0AHiuLjZBtkhcCaDNOkYyPp4CjBCL9u7UnYZDt13QG29e51ksisB4RVIJ3G 8VAr7IByGBn9g38Ipah08uLWmayRB5MwjiNIMw6YU69WnFoNYk++LAoqoPUtl1q9Qn 7rccTezxxr43/KzLysVrgBSNHnBuGMagN+W7qmaozQFG/CL13b8jwINw+FrA6R0po3 Ok4QlwpoyWu/66UKrqNs90GppCOL5EL8GhFL0R0byFSRYIdR0HU6TI5f6obKNjBrAx IY2L7WRFPLUiw== Received: from customer (localhost [127.0.0.1]) by submission (posteo.de) with ESMTPSA id 4Nr5Hp6LNRz9rxG; Mon, 9 Jan 2023 08:32:20 +0100 (CET) References: <867cxxxgfv.fsf@riseup.net> <663DEABC-D27B-4E6F-B0E8-4B2ADF609F4A@lepiller.eu> <86fsck6bw4.fsf@riseup.net> <86tu10iiws.fsf@riseup.net> From: pukkamustard To: Csepp Cc: Julien Lepiller , Guix Devel Subject: Re: Packaging OCaml repositories that define multiple packages? Date: Mon, 09 Jan 2023 07:17:21 +0000 In-reply-to: <86tu10iiws.fsf@riseup.net> Message-ID: <86sfgkyxh9.fsf@posteo.net> MIME-Version: 1.0 Content-Type: text/plain Received-SPF: pass client-ip=185.67.36.66; envelope-from=pukkamustard@posteo.net; helo=mout02.posteo.de X-Spam_score_int: -43 X-Spam_score: -4.4 X-Spam_bar: ---- X-Spam_report: (-4.4 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, RCVD_IN_DNSWL_MED=-2.3, RCVD_IN_MSPIKE_H2=-0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: guix-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+larch=yhetil.org@gnu.org Sender: guix-devel-bounces+larch=yhetil.org@gnu.org X-Migadu-Country: US X-Migadu-Flow: FLOW_IN 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1673249587;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post:dkim-signature; bh=CGY4xZBBjFcKsf/805vY0DSQ43+Imj+mYuZzgDlpK30=; b=qDzDRGOIQxVQGXHYLjzhFcz0wbEx2qu6A+lfOqloR8HfLduP6k/WvNf4tt+MCMa/PPqMFQ ufv9TSlllPthU4cNHBOIm18D+3M5hBk55heucAZlVjEIbXpti/WPGi8jNOeBtoF1Hht1n8 c2nHAZnSX6iD8KO+XW4oXEo6/xlTaDKmhytau110BMutXFzfgdQ1Ec6vzt54+L1m+ir7hD lq4bLOyemiuy9cTXyYHSDB6RbLFeWcOpL3+SCY8RZBgqq9fMu+0r5pavCxaWb9wvHwHpwb ZwgIjgdrS32iXm5SFRdzelg+LK/zIaat6pB0l3dbvV68R7X9/uzyZ/DT93gf2A==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=pass header.d=posteo.net header.s=2017 header.b=HpKI9Iu4; spf=pass (aspmx1.migadu.com: domain of "guix-devel-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-devel-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=posteo.net ARC-Seal: i=1; s=key1; d=yhetil.org; t=1673249587; a=rsa-sha256; cv=none; b=BgkC/hLxHLFEfk44m4d28DCCy9b/wgXzOygqoXwWN4oie9hbgoPhCbh7776VtIBTBqglXM xKp6uEi+uS3KLTECyvqau0DLSggPZfYpuF97EvgT3JctzKJ8fMHHp/tn0lNUpjg9QoLwQS NKFz4L2C5Mzo9Tl3rUqJHxnLYm4jpH0l1qNWl5zvPyLOw9KYlV26d1tVsqlWb35X6OkX9b poUq4p1t4bdy2Z+7H/8tqmiJXRXWV3vPyr3+d6G5tMd3HO51qPs0IYVYXP3CgIeJrhkfcB B3rot8yrLhwQaCn/fWZDBtSH7NSBf/P3MSohHtMsAuxSf3/FNf1IFWrvLklbSw== X-Spam-Score: -5.51 X-Migadu-Queue-Id: 8C5B42558C Authentication-Results: aspmx1.migadu.com; dkim=pass header.d=posteo.net header.s=2017 header.b=HpKI9Iu4; spf=pass (aspmx1.migadu.com: domain of "guix-devel-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="guix-devel-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=posteo.net X-Migadu-Scanner: scn1.migadu.com X-Migadu-Spam-Score: -5.51 X-TUID: KhCqn16oWSx+ Csepp writes: > But there are packages that were added by others that already specify > which subpackage they build, and yet seem to be accepted as subpackages. Do you have an example? And maybe send in your patches, that may provide more context around this discussion.